Eureka Forbes Q2 net profit rises 32% to ₹62 crore

Eureka Forbes Limited, for the second quarter ended September 30, 2025, reported 32% Year over Year (YoY) growth in standalone net profit to ₹61.6 crore. Revenue from operations increased 14.9% YoY to ₹773.4 crore.

Pratik Pota, MD, and CEO, Eureka Forbes Limited said, “In an uncertain and evolving external environment, Q2 FY26 was an exciting milestone quarter for us. We delivered a strong revenue growth of 14.9% YoY and EBITDA crossed ₹100 crore for the first time at a lifetime high margin of 13.1%.”

“Our revenue growth came on the back of a high-teens growth in products, with all our categories growing well. In Water, growth came on the back of a scale up of our 2-year range which reduces the cost of ownership significantly. In cleaning, the biggest engine of growth was the robotics segment which performed well across all channels. With this quarter, we have now delivered double digit product growth in every single quarter in the last two years,” he said.“The service business turnaround accelerated with a strong, double-digit growth in service bookings. Our customer experience improved further, with service levels reaching lifetime highs,” he added.
